A Goal That Transcended the Pitch

In a tense World Cup showdown, Argentina and Switzerland traded blows until the 112th minute, when Lautaro Martinez found the net with a decisive strike that sent the stadium into a frenzy.

The celebration that followed was anything but ordinary. Martinez vaulted over the LED advertising boards, racing toward the stands to exchange a high‑five with fans who had been cheering him from the sidelines.

Captured by veteran AP photographer Ashley Landis, the scene was framed by a 400mm f2.8 lens, isolating Martinez’s exuberant expression against a backdrop of jubilant supporters.

Landis, based in Houston, Texas, has spent years covering international soccer, and his work often hinges on anticipating those split‑second moments when emotion spikes.

The photograph not only showcases Martinez’s athletic prowess but also his willingness to connect with the crowd, a gesture that resonates deeply with fans worldwide.
